1.Hypericin ameliorates stress-induced depressive-like behaviors in mice by modulating the CN-NFAT calcium signaling pathway in microglia.
Zhengtao GAO ; Pingyan LIN ; Bingcan ZHOU ; Mingheng CHEN ; Erqi LIU ; Tianxiang LEI ; Huixin NI ; Haixin LIU ; Yao LIN ; Qian XU
Journal of Southern Medical University 2025;45(3):506-513
OBJECTIVES:
To investigate the role of the calcium/calmodulin (CaM)-mediated activation of calcineurin (CN)-nuclear factor of activated T cells (NFAT) signaling pathway in mediating the regulatory effect of hyperforin (HY) on stress-induced depression-like disorder (DP) in mice.
METHODS:
C57BL/6J mice were randomly divided into control group, DP model group, and hyperforin treatment group (n=15). Behavioral changes of the mice were assessed using open field test (OFT), sucrose preference test (SPT), tail suspension test (TST), light/dark box test (LDB), and novel object suppression test (NSFT). Immunohistochemistry was used to detect tyrosine hydroxylase (TH) expression in the CA1 region of the hippocampus, and serum serotonin (5-HT) and norepinephrine (NA) levels were detected with ELISA. Western blotting was used to analyze the expressions of TNF-α, IL-1β, IL-2, and CN-NFAT pathway proteins. In cultured BV-2 microglial cells with lipopolysaccharide (LPS) stimulation, the effects of hyperforin and CN inhibitor (CNIS) on expressions of ionized calcium-binding adapter molecule 1 (IBA-1), 5-HT, NA, inflammatory cytokines and CN-NFAT pathway proteins were examined using immunofluorescence assay, ELISA or Western blotting.
RESULTS:
Compared with the control mice, the mice in DP group showed significantly reduced activity in OFT, decreased sucrose consumption in SPT, reduced shuttle crossing in LDB, and lowered food intake in NSFT with significantly increased immobility in TST. The mice with DP showed significantly decreased TH-positive neurons, lowered 5-HT and NA levels, and increased expressions of TNF-α, IL-1β, IL-2 and CaM-CN-NFAT pathway proteins. In cultured BV-2 cells, LPS stimulation strongly increased cellular IBA-1 expression, decreased the levels of neurotransmitters (5-HT and NA), and increased the levels of inflammatory cytokines and CN-NFAT signaling, and these changes were effectively reversed by treatment with hyperforin or CNIS.
CONCLUSIONS
Hyperforin improves stress-induced depression-like behaviors in mice and activated BV-2 cells by targeting the CN-NFAT signaling pathway.

2.Preliminary study on coronary artery image quality and calcified plaque evaluation using ultra-high-resolution photon-counting detector CT
Yaru YANG ; Yan'e ZHAO ; Huixin ZHANG ; Yong YUAN ; Qiuju HU ; Jiliang CHEN ; Yujie GAO ; Dongsheng JIN ; Song LUO ; Guangming LU
Chinese Journal of Radiology 2025;59(12):1361-1368
Objective:To investigate the differential impact of ultra-high-resolution photon-counting detector CT (UHR PCD-CT) and energy-integrating detector CT (EID-CT) on image quality and calcified plaque-induced luminal stenosis in coronary CT angiography (CCTA).Methods:This retrospective analysis was conducted on patients who underwent both EID-CT and UHR PCD-CT CCTA at the Geriatric Hospital of Nanjing Medical University between January 2021 and November 2024. A total of 141 patients were included in the study, within 46 patients having scans within a 12-month interval. Image quality of all coronary artery segments was subjectively evaluated. Patients with paired scans (interval≤12 months) were included for calcified plaque analysis. Subjective visualization of calcified plaques evaluated. The blooming artifact was calculated as an objective evaluation index for assessing the calcified plaques. Additionally, the degree of coronary artery lumen stenosis resulting from calcified plaques was assessed, along with the measurement of plaque volume and the Agatston score. Changes in lumen stenosis between the two scans were also evaluated. The Wilcoxon signed-rank test was used to compare the subjective scores of coronary artery image quality and calcified plaques between the two groups, and paired-sample t-tests were used to compare the blooming artifact and lumen stenosis degree. Results:The PCD-CT image quality score was significantly higher than that of EID-CT [PCD-CT : 5 (4,5), EID-CT: 4 (4,5); Z=-21.38, P<0.001]. Compared to EID-CT, PCD-CT reduced the blooming artifact (PCD-CT: 38.88%±9.09%, EID-CT: 50.11%±11.52%; t=-12.97, P<0.001), significantly improving the subjective score for visualization of calcified plaques [PCD-CT: 5 (4,5), EID-CT: 3 (2,3); Z=-9.68, P<0.001], and the measured lumen stenosis was notably lower in PCD-CT(PCD-CT:34.88%±18.20%, EID-CT:45.31%±23.42%; t=-9.93, P<0.001). Among 129 analyzed calcified plaques, luminal stenosis was reduced on PCD-CT in 110 plaques (85.3%) and increased in 19 (14.7%), including 4 plaques that had unclear boundaries with the adjacent lumen in EID-CT CCTA images, making the stenosis difficult to assess. Conclusion:Compared to EID-CT, UHR PCD-CT for CCTA significantly improves coronary artery image quality, provides clearer visualization of calcified plaques and adjacent lumen details, and it can reduce the overestimation of coronary artery caleified plaque stenosis.
3.Epidemiological Characteristics of Malignant Tumors in Cancer Registration Areas of Heilongjiang Province in 2019 and the Trend from 2013 to 2019
Wanying WANG ; Huixin SUN ; Maoxiang ZHANG ; Haihan JIA ; Min ZHAO ; Guohong GAO ; Bingbing SONG
China Cancer 2025;34(5):368-376
[Purpose]To analyze the incidence and mortality of malignant tumors in cancer regis-tration areas of Heilongjiang Province in 2019 and the trend from 2013 to 2019.[Methods]The incidence and mortality data of malignant tumors reported by the Heilongjiang provincial cancer registries from 2013 to 2019 were collected,and the quality of data was assessed.The crude in-cidence/mortality rate,age-standardized incidence/mortality rate by Chinese standard population(ASIRC/ASMRC)and world standard population(ASIRW/ASMRW),0~74 years old cumulative rate were calculated.Joinpoint 4.6.0 software was used to calculate the average annual percentage change(AAPC)of ASIRC/ASMRC for the trend analysis from 2013 to 2019.[Results]In 2019,there were 16 732 new cases of malignant tumors in the cancer registration areas of Heilongjiang Province,including 8 639 males and 8 093 females.The crude incidence rate was 295.37/105,with an ASIRC and ASIRW of 167.10/105 and 164.18/105,respectively.There were 10 988 malig-nant tumor deaths,including 6 540 males and 4 448 females.The crude mortality rate was 193.97/105,with an ASMRC and ASMRW of 101.22/105 and 101.66/105,respectively.The inci-dence and mortality of malignant tumors increased rapidly after the age of 55,and the incidence and mortality of males were slightly higher than those of females.The top five malignant tumors of high incidence were lung cancer,female breast cancer,colorectal cancer,liver cancer and thy-roid cancer,and the top five malignant tumors of high mortality were lung cancer,liver cancer,colorectal cancer,stomach cancer and female breast cancer.From 2013 to 2019,the ASIRC of malignant tumors in cancer registration areas increased from 153.08/105 in 2013 to 167.10/105 in 2019,and the ASMRC increased from 92.22/105 in 2013 to 101.22/105 in 2019,but there was no statistical difference in the change trend.[Conclusion]The incidence and mortality of malignant tumors in Heilongjiang Province remain high.Lung cancer,female breast cancer,colorectal can-cer,liver cancer and stomach cancer should be the focus of cancer prevention and control.

6.Correlation analysis of serum Chemerin with disease activity and Th17/Treg in patients with rheumatoid arthritis
Wenjing XU ; Dongmei GAO ; Huixin LI ; Li WANG ; Shengquan TONG
Tianjin Medical Journal 2024;52(2):193-196
Objective To explore the correlation of serum Chemerin level with disease activity and the ratio of T helper 17/regulatory T cells(Th17/Treg)in patients with rheumatoid arthritis(RA).Methods A total of 180 patients with RA who were admitted to our hospital were regarded as the observation group.According to the DAS28 score,the observation group was divided into the high activity group(60 cases),the moderate activity group(60 cases)and the low activity group(60 cases).Another 180 healthy people who underwent physical examination in our hospital during the same period were regarded as the control group.Enzyme-linked immunosorbent assay(ELISA)was used to detect serum levels of Chemerin,interleukin-9(IL-9),interleukin-10(IL-10)and interleukin-17(IL-17).Flow cytometry was used to detect the Th17/Treg ratio.Spearman correlation analysis was applied to analyze the correlation between serum Chemerin level and DAS28 score.Pearson correlation analysis was used to analyze the correlation between serum Chemerin level and Th17,Treg cell percentage and Th17/Treg ratio.Results The results of this study showed that the serum level of Chemerin was higher in the observation group than that in the control group(P<0.05).The serum Chemerin level was positively correlated with DAS28 score(P<0.05).Serum Chemerin levels and DAS28 scores decreased in turn in the high,moderate and low activity groups(P<0.05).The percentage of Th17 cells and the ratio of Th17/Treg were higher in the observation group than those in the control group,and the percentage of Treg cells was lower in the observation group than that in the control group(P<0.05).The level of IL-10 was lower in the observation group than that in the control group,while levels of IL-17 and IL-9 were higher in the observation group than those in the control group(P<0.05).The results of Pearson correlation analysis showed that serum Chemerin level was positively correlated with the percentage of Th17 cells and the ratio of Th17/Treg,and negatively correlated with the percentage of Treg cells(P<0.05).Conclusion Serum Chemerin level is elevated in patients with RA,which is closely related to disease activity and Th17/Treg ratio.
7.Epidemiological and clinical characteristics of Keshan disease current cases in Qingyang City, Gansu Province in 2022
Jing LUO ; Yun WANG ; Ping LI ; Xiaoliang SUN ; Huixin DENG ; Qian YANG ; Zhaoyan HU ; Ying GAO
Chinese Journal of Endemiology 2024;43(12):968-971
Objective:To investigate the epidemiological and clinical characteristics of Keshan disease current cases in Qingyang City, Gansu Province.Methods:Full coverage monitoring data of all Keshan disease affected villages in Qingyang City from January to December 2022 were collected from the database of the Qingyang City Center for Disease Prevention and Control. A retrospective analysis was conducted to analyze the epidemiological distribution and clinical manifestations (including electrocardiography, classification of cardiac function, chest X-ray, B-mode ultrasound of the heart, etc) of 132 current cases of Keshan disease.Results:Among the 132 current cases of Keshan disease, there were 5 cases of latent type and 127 cases of chronic type, and 25 new cases were identified in 2022; with a male-to-female ratio of 1.03 ∶ 1.00 (67 ∶ 65), a median age of 62 years (interquartile range of 12). The area with the highest number of current cases was Heshui County, with a Keshan disease incidence rate of 3.37/10 000; the lower areas were Xifeng District and Zhenyuan County, with a Keshan disease incidence rate of 0.08/10 000 and 0.03/10 000, respectively. The abnormal electrocardiogram of the current cases was mainly characterized by T-wave and/or ST-segment changes, with a total of 78 cases, accounting for 59.09% of the total cases. Heart function impairment (grade Ⅱ and above) was found in 124 cases, accounting for 93.94%. The results of B-mode ultrasound and chest X-ray examination showed that there were 107 cases of heart enlargement, accounting for 81.06% of the total cases.Conclusions:The Keshan disease current cases in Qingyang City are predominantly chronic in elderly, with a balanced gender distribution but regional distribution differences. Abnormal electrocardiogram is common in patients, and their cardiac function is often impaired. Given the persistent presence of pathogenic factors, continued monitoring is necessary to achieve early intervention and improve prognosis.

9.Design and practice of general population cohort study in northeastern China
Hehua ZHANG ; Qing CHANG ; Qijun WU ; Yang XIA ; Shanyan GAO ; Yixiao ZHANG ; Yuan YUAN ; Jing JIANG ; Hongbin QIU ; Jing LI ; Chunming LU ; Chao JI ; Xin XU ; Donghui HUANG ; Huixu DAI ; Zhiying ZHAO ; Xing LI ; Xiaoying LI ; Xiaosong QIN ; Caigang LIU ; Xiaoyu MA ; Xinrui XU ; Da YAO ; Huixin YU ; Yuhong ZHAO
Chinese Journal of Epidemiology 2023;44(1):21-27
In 2016, a national one million general population cohort project was set up in China for the first time in "Precision Medicine Research" Key Project, National Key Research and Development Program of China, which consists of general population cohorts in seven areas in China. As one of the seven major areas in China, northeastern China has unique climate and specific dietary patterns, and population aging is serious in this area. And the burden of chronic and non-communicable diseases ranks tops in China. Therefore, it is of great significance to establish a large general population cohort in northeastern China to explore the area specific exposure factors related to pathogenesis and prognosis of chronic and non-communicable diseases, develop new prevention strategies to reduce the burden of the diseases and improve the population health in northeastern China. In July 2018, the general population cohort study in northeastern China was launched, the study includes questionnaire survey, health examination and blood, urine and stool sample collection and detection in recruited participants. By now, the cohort has covered all age groups, and the baseline data of 115 414 persons have been collected. This paper summarizes the design and practice of the general population cohort study in northeastern China to provide reference for related research in China.
10.Detection of antibodies against SARS-CoV-2 as a serologic marker of infection in patients with COVID-19
Shuangyan LU ; Lin WU ; Chengyu LIU ; Jing YU ; Huixin CHEN ; Jiajia GAO ; Yanhong ZHANG ; Lu TAN ; Pengcheng LI ; Juan LIU ; Yao ZHENG ; Shun WANG
Chinese Journal of Blood Transfusion 2021;34(8):861-864
【Objective】 To investigate the diagnostic value of severe acute respiratory syndrome coronavirus 2 (SARSCoV-2) specific antibodies IgM and IgG on coronavirus disease 2019 (COVID-19). 【Methods】 1) The test results of SARS-CoV-2 IgM/IgG antibodies and nucleic acid(NAT), which were tested by colloidal gold test and fluorescent quantitative PCR respectively, were collected from 145 febrile outpatients during early March, 2020, named Fever group, in which retrospective analysis and paired chi-square test were performed. 2) 612 cases of SARS-CoV-2 IgM/IgG antibodies test results, which were done on March 5, 2020, were collected. They were named COVID-19 group (Our hospital was provisionally assigned as a specialized hospital for COVID-19, and 1500 COVID-19 patients admitted to our hospital from February 12, 2020 to March 18, 2020). The SARS-CoV-2 IgM/IgG antibodies and NAT were respectively tested on the 30th and the 60th day after the date of discharge. The clinical application values of the antibodies was clarified by statistical analysis. 【Results】 1) In the fever group, the positive rate of SARS-CoV-2 IgM, IgG and IgM+ IgG antibodies were 26.21% (38/145), 54.48% (79/145) and 26.21% (38/145), respectively(P<0.01), and the positive rate of NAT was 4.14% (6/145), which was lower than that of antibody (P<0.01). One (1/145, 0.69%) positive NAT was implicated in initially negative IgM and IgG antibodies samples. 2) In the COVID-19 group, the positive rate of IgM antibody was low (5%) and IgG antibody was high (65%) during 2~14 days after infection, and stably increased during the 15~56 days [IgM 47.68%(277/581) vs IgG 94.15% (547/581) ], then both decreased after 57 days. The positive rates of IgM antibody and IgG antibody were 45.8% (280/612) and 93.1% (570/612) in 612 patients during hospitalization. 15 patients′ data after dischange were not collected as they were later transferred to Huoshenshan Hospital for treatment. The coronavirus NAT results of the rest 597 COVID-19 patients, tested on the 30th and 60th days after the date of discharge, were negative, and the positive rates of IgG antibody and IgM antibody were still ≥80% and ≥40% respectively at the second month after discharge. 【Conclusion】 IgM, IgG antibody against SARS-CoV-2 can be well detected by Colloidal gold method(Innovita), whose positive rate is higher than that of NAT. IgG antibody is produced earlier than IgM, and it keeps high positive rate and persists for a long time. The combination of colloidal gold antibody test and NAT can improve the diagnose rate of COVID-19 and the exclusion of suspected cases.
